The Cisco 300-720 exam, also known as the Securing Email with Cisco Email Security Appliance (SESA) exam, is a certification exam that tests your knowledge and skills in securing email communication with the use of the Cisco Email Security Appliance.

The exam consists of 60-70 questions and lasts for 90 minutes.
The questions are presented in various formats, including multiple-choice, drag-and-drop, and simulation questions. The exam is available in English and Japanese.

The topics covered in the exam include:

1. Secure Email Gateway Architecture and Features

2. Cisco Email Security Appliance Installation and Configuration

3. Message Filtering

4. Email Encryption

5. System Administration and Troubleshooting

The exam can be taken at any Pearson VUE testing center, and the cost of the exam is $300 USD.
To prepare for the exam, Cisco offers a range of resources, including self-paced e-learning courses, instructor-led training courses, and study groups.

Cisco 300-720 SESA (Securing Email with Cisco Email Security Appliance) certification is designed for professionals who want to specialize in email security.

It validates the knowledge and skills required to configure, manage, and troubleshoot Cisco Email Security Appliances, as well as to implement email security solutions.

The value of Cisco 300-720 SESA certification is that it provides the following benefits:

1. Expertise in Email Security: This certification demonstrates that you have expertise in email security, including threat protection, email encryption, and email filtering. It also validates your ability to configure, manage, and troubleshoot Cisco Email Security Appliances.

2. Career Opportunities: This certification enhances your career opportunities by validating your expertise in email security. It can open up new job opportunities and increase your earning potential.

3. Recognition: Cisco is a well-known and respected brand in the IT industry, and earning a Cisco certification demonstrates your commitment to your profession and your dedication to staying up-to-date with the latest technologies and best practices.

4. Competitive Advantage: Cisco 300-720 SESA certification provides a competitive advantage over non-certified professionals. It demonstrates your commitment to your profession and your willingness to invest in your career development.

5. Professional Growth: This certification also provides opportunities for professional growth by providing access to training, resources, and networking opportunities with other Cisco-certified professionals.

In summary, Cisco 300-720 SESA certification validates your expertise in email security, enhances your career opportunities, provides recognition and competitive advantage, and supports your professional growth.
